Though vinegar can be used alone as an effective cleaner for most areas of a car, it can also be combined with baking soda for additional cleaning power when removing stubborn stains. Mix the hot water and distilled white vinegar and add it to the steam cleaner. Scrub leather or vinyl seats with toothpaste and a toothbrush, and spruce up leather with equal parts vinegar and linseed oil.
